Three boys, one youth injured while bursting Deepavali crackers


Team Udayavani, Nov 9, 2018, 10:13 AM IST

Udupi: The pleasure of bursting crackers during deepavali comes with its own dangers and it proved so to four people, including three boys who were reportedly injured while bursting crackers in the district in the past three days.

Of the injured include a young boy from Udupi and a 14-year-old boy from Kunjibettu, who was admitted to the Udupi district hospital on November 7th. Also, a 25-year-old youth from Paniyur Uchila, suffered eye injuries on Nov 6th and a 11-year-old boy in Alavoor Manipal met with the same fate the next day. Both the injured were admitted to Prasad Nethralaya Eye Hospital in Udupi.
